Learn French through today’s real news. Slow, clear French at A1, with a full transcript and English translation.

In this episode: A new HIV drug works very well and is given only twice a year, but its rollout raises questions about who gets it first. Also: Eurovision 2027 will be held in Burgas, Bulgaria, by the Black Sea.

Aujourd'hui : Nouveau médicament contre le VIH · Eurovision 2027 à Burgas.

Today’s French focus: se donner, to be given / to be administered = to be given / to be administered. Vocabulary: médicament (medicine), injection (injection), dose (dose).
